Can GeForce RTX 3060 run Panic Delivery?

Great

The GeForce RTX 3060 handles Panic Delivery well at 1080p, delivering approximately 425 FPS at High settings — above the 60 FPS target for smooth gameplay. It can also achieve smooth 1440p at around 319 FPS.

Minimum System Requirements

CPU
Intel®Core i5-4460, 2.70GHz or AMD FX-6300 or better
GPU
NVIDIA GeForce GTX 760 or AMD Radeon R7 260x with 2 GB Video RAM
RAM
8 GB
